Air India Flight Crashes at Ahmedabad Airport During Take-Off

An Air India flight bound for London crashed during take-off at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el International Airport in Ahmedabad. The incident led to an immediate emergency response with over five fire-fighting vehicles deployed. Reports suggest that several of the 242 passengers onboard were injured. The cause of the crash and the extent of the damage are still under investigation. Airport authorities have initiated an internal inquiry, and further updates are awaited from Air India and the Directorate General of Civil Aviation (DGCA).
